Two factories producing textiles are next door to one another, Indigo Inc. and Ruby Co. Indigo Inc. uses more modern looms than Ruby Co. Therefore, the accident rate at Indigo Inc. is 1 in 5 workers per year while the accident rate at Ruby Co. is only 1 in 15 workers per year. Workers at Indigo make $25,000/year and workers at Ruby make $35,000/year. There are 1,000 workers at each factory.
a. What is the statistical value that workers place on factory accidents?
b. There are 5 per thousand fatal accidents per year at Indigo and 7 per thousand accidents per year at Ruby. What is the statistical value of the life of a factory worker?
